myfaces-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Apache Wiki <wikidi...@apache.org>
Subject [Myfaces Wiki] Update of "CoreRelease121" by LeonardoUribe
Date Thu, 20 Dec 2007 02:03:16 GMT
Dear Wiki user,

You have subscribed to a wiki page or wiki category on "Myfaces Wiki" for change notification.

The following page has been changed by LeonardoUribe:
http://wiki.apache.org/myfaces/CoreRelease121

------------------------------------------------------------------------------
  
     * Checkout 3.0.1 branch and install on local repository
  
- 8. Preparing core 1.2.1
+ 9. Preparing core 1.2.1
  
      * Set all dependencies to org.apache.myfaces.shared artifacts to version "3.0.1" (instead
of 3.0.1-SNAPSHOT)
      * remove snapshot plugin dependences
@@ -271, +271 @@

  
     * Checkout 1.2.1 branch and install on local repository
  
- 9. Deploy shared and core on local repo
+ 10. Deploy shared and core on local repo
  
     * release shared 3.0.1 SUCCESS
  
@@ -287, +287 @@

  
  #
  
- 10. JIRA release management (1.2.1-SNAPSHOT --> 1.2.1)
+ 11. JIRA release management (1.2.1-SNAPSHOT --> 1.2.1)
  
      * Add a new version 1.2.1 to the core project
      * Add a new version 1.2.2-SNAPSHOT to the core project
@@ -295, +295 @@

      * Do a bulk change for all resolved (but not closed) in 1.2.1 and close them
      * Archive the 1.2.1-SNAPSHOT version
  
- 11. Vote while TCK test passes
+ 12. Vote while TCK test passes
  
- 12. Errors on trunk and need to release org.apache.myfaces.trinidadbuild maven-faces-plugin
+ 13. Errors on trunk and need to release org.apache.myfaces.trinidadbuild maven-faces-plugin
  
- 13. Preparing trinidad-maven plugins
+ 14. Preparing trinidad-maven plugins
  
      * -DdryRun=true SUCCESS!   
  
@@ -328, +328 @@

     * move tag subdir created to branches
     * Correct SCM properties
  
- 14. Deploy as written in POM SUCCESS!!
+ 15. Deploy as written in POM SUCCESS!!
  
  {{{
  mvn clean source:jar install deploy -DaltDeploymentRepository=myfaces-local-staging::default::scp://localhost/home/lu4242/stage/repot
-Prelease
  }}}
  
- 15. Move LICENSE and NOTICE to META-INF folder in trunk and prepare folder
+ 16. Move LICENSE and NOTICE to META-INF folder in trunk SUCCESS!!!
  
+ 17. Rename again on core prepare and others to do all tasks again (The changes previously
done affects just core release and not shared, so shared is fine)
+ 
+ 18. Preparing core 1.2.1
+ 
+     * Copy trunk-1.2.x on prepare
+     * Set all dependencies to org.apache.myfaces.shared artifacts to version "3.0.1" (instead
of 3.0.1-SNAPSHOT)
+     * Set all dependencies to org.apache.myfaces.trinidadbuild artifacts to version "1.2.6"
(instead of 1.2.6-SNAPSHOT)
+     * Commit on prepare
+     * -DdryRun=true SUCCESS!
+ 
+ {{{
+ mvn release:prepare -DtagBase=https://svn.apache.org/repos/asf/myfaces/core/branches -Dusername=lu4242
-Dscm.password=??? -Dtag=1_2_1 -DdryRun=true
+ }}}
+ 
+     * -Dresume=false SUCCESS!
+ 
+ {{{
+ mvn release:prepare -DtagBase=https://svn.apache.org/repos/asf/myfaces/core/branches -Dusername=lu4242
-Dscm.password=??? -Dtag=1_2_1 -Dresume=false
+ }}}
+ 
+    * Checkout 1.2.1 branch and install on local repository
+ 
+ 
+ 19. Deploy shared and core on local repo
+ 
+    * release shared 3.0.1 SUCCESS
+ 
+ {{{
+ mvn clean deploy -DaltDeploymentRepository=myfaces-local-staging::default::scp://localhost/home/lu4242/stage/repo
-Psign-artifacts -Dpassphrase=??? 
+ }}}
+    
+    * release core 1.2.1 SUCCESS
+ 
+ {{{
+ mvn clean deploy -DaltDeploymentRepository=myfaces-local-staging::default::scp://localhost/home/lu4242/stage/repo
-Psign-artifacts -Dpassphrase=??? 
+ }}}
+ 
+    * copy manually using scp to the account on people.apache.org. Due to a bug on linux
http://jira.codehaus.org/browse/MDEPLOY-62 deploy not work on linux. SUCCESS
+ 
+ {{{
+    cd home/lu4242/stage/repo
+    scp -p -r org lu4242@people.apache.org:/home/lu4242/public_html/myfaces121
+ }}}
+ 
+ 
+ 20. JIRA release management
+ 
+     * Add MYFACES-1790 to 1.2.1 fix version
+     * Find issues fixed with no fix version but that belongs to JSF 1.2, attach to 1.2.1
and close them.
+ 
+ 21. Message on vote to announce fix for these two problems
+ 

Mime
View raw message